The Anesthesia Technologist is an important member of the operating theatre team. The Anesthesia

Technologist will carry out the following tasks:

  • Consults Operating Room schedule to determine supply and equipment needs for procedures
  • Sets up, tests, calibrates and operates complex physiologic monitors such as anesthesia workstations, intubation/airway devices, fiber optic endoscopes, physiologic monitors and infusion devices
  • Troubleshoots anesthesia equipment malfunctions, routing non-functional equipment to the proper department for repair
  • Supports anesthesia providers using aseptic or sterile technique with non-invasive and invasive patient procedures including peripheral and/or central intravenous and/or arterial line placement; airway management techniques including mask, endotracheal and/or emergency methods and regional anesthesia techniques
  • Inserts peripheral intravenous catheters after validating competency
  • Leads in the preparation of the patient for surgery and performs pre-operative assessments as requested by the anesthesiologist
  • Ensures anesthesia providers have physiologic monitoring of patients notifying the anesthesia provider(s) of abnormal changes in vital signs and/or physical appearance of the patient
  • Supports intra-hospital patient transport, insuring integrity of all monitoring and/or circulatory support devices
  • Participates in the operating room infection control programs by performing duties such as maintaining cleanliness in anesthetic equipment in accordance with quality assurance programs
  • Ensures strict adherence to established procedures to minimize operating room pollution
  • Maintains appropriate supplies and equipment in supply carts, report needs/usage to supervisor as required
  • Obtains supplies and equipment as requested by anesthesia providers
  • Assists with patient laboratory tests and results including, but not limited to, ABG's, ACTs and other point of care tests
  • Obtains blood products and pharmaceuticals assisting with preparation and delivery
  • Maintains immediate availability to assist in routine and emergency procedures
  • Participates in patient education programs
  • Develops and sustains (maintains) own knowledge, clinical skills (mandatory training) and professional (portfolio or profile) awareness and maintains a professional profile
  • Provides documented evidence of performance and maintenance of skills consistent with position
